Specifications
Name Value
Type Parameter
Factory Lead Time 4 Weeks
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 44-VFQFN Exposed Pad
Operating Temperature -40°C~85°C
Packaging Tape & Reel (TR)
Published 1997
Part Status Not For New Designs
Moisture Sensitivity Level (MSL) 2 (1 Year)
Number of Terminations 44
ECCN Code EAR99
Additional Feature ALSO REQUIRES 3.3V SUPPLY
Subcategory Clock Generators
Voltage - Supply 1.71V~3.47V
Terminal Position QUAD
Terminal Form NO LEAD
Peak Reflow Temperature (Cel) 260
Supply Voltage 1.8V
Terminal Pitch 0.5mm
Time@Peak Reflow Temperature-Max (s) 40
Output CML, HCSL, LVCMOS, LVDS, LVPECL
JESD-30 Code S-XQCC-N44
Qualification Status Not Qualified
Number of Circuits 1
uPs/uCs/Peripheral ICs Type CLOCK GENERATOR, PROCESSOR SPECIFIC
Supply Current-Max 230mA
Frequency (Max) 350MHz
Input LVCMOS, LVDS, LVPECL, Crystal
Ratio - Input:Output 5:4
Primary Clock/Crystal Frequency-Nom 54MHz
PLL Yes
Differential - Input:Output Yes/Yes
Divider/Multiplier Yes/No
Height Seated (Max) 0.9mm
Length 7mm
Width 7mm
RoHS Status RoHS Compliant
